Also, the conolidine molecule did not connect with the classical receptors, which means that it would not contend versus opioid peptides to bind to those receptors.
2020). ACKR3 functions being a 'scavenger' that 'traps' the secreted opioids and stops them from binding on the classical receptors, thereby dampening their analgesic activity and acting for a regulator of the opioid program.

These final results suggest that conolidine is able to limit the ACKR3 receptor’s negative regulatory Houses and liberate opioid peptides, letting them to bind into the classical opioid receptors and endorse analgesic activity.

We shown that, in distinction to classical opioid receptors, ACKR3 won't induce classical G protein signaling and is not modulated via the classical prescription or analgesic opioids, which include morphine, fentanyl, or buprenorphine, or by nonselective opioid antagonists for instance naloxone. Alternatively, we set up that LIH383, an ACKR3-selective subnanomolar competitor peptide, helps prevent ACKR3’s damaging regulatory function on opioid peptides in an ex vivo rat brain model and potentiates their exercise toward classical opioid receptors.
